Michael Taylor Movies
- 2023
No Way Home
No Way Home02023HD
Set in a industrial wasteland, a young boy discovers a injured man who he thinks is his father.
- 2008
Vandals
Vandals4.82008HD
Two male graffiti artists are partners in their work, but they are also having a sexual relationship with each other which they haven't disclosed to...